Bobby Shmurda is still in jail. Earlier reports had his record company, Epic Records picking up the tab…

Epic Records came to the rescue at Bobby Shmurda’s indictment in a huge way… New York, Police Commissioner Bill Bratton and Special Narcotics Prosecutor Bridget G. Brennan, said Bobby Shmurda was found with two guns, one on his lap and one lodged beside him in a car outside Quad Studios late last night, while three more guns were found hidden in the Studio’s stairwell, according to investigators. In all, 15 arrests were made and 21 guns were recovered.

Bail was set at 2 million dollars. Darla Miles from WABC-TV 7, confirmed Epic records will post the 2 million dollars bail. Dean Meminger from NY1 News, tweeted out photos from the press conference.
